For the Petitioner : Mr. Raghav Prasad, Advocate. For the Opposite Party : Mr. Sucheta Yadav (App) ====================================================== CORAM: HONOURABLE MR. JUSTICE DINESH KUMAR SINGH ORAL ORDER 18-02-2015 Heard learned counsels for the petitioner and the State.
The petitioner is apprehending his arrest in a case registered for the offences punishable under Section 366A/34 of the Indian Penal Code.
The accusation is of kidnapping the minor daughter of the informant.
It is submitted by learned counsel for the petitioner that the petitioner married with the victim girl and now they have three children and the informant has retracted from his initial version and filed a petition to that effect before the learned court below.
Since the case was instituted in 2005, this Court is not inclined to grant anticipatory bail. The aforesaid facts may be considered by the learned
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.33775 of 2014 (3) dt.18-02-2015 2 / 2 court below while considering prayer for regular bail of the petitioner if he surrenders within a period of six weeks from the date of receipt of copy of this order in connection with Jamo Bazar P.S. Case No. 54 of 2005 pending in the court of the learned C.J.M. Siwan.
With this observation, the application is disposed off.
